The Government of the Republic of Kazakhstan has approved the concept of developing the state language by 2029, which will become the main language in the field of public service. Some political officials will need to know the Kazakh language. This was reported by TASS Referring to the decision of the country’s Council of Ministers.

“During the implementation of the concept, requirements will be developed that oblige individual political officials to speak the Kazakh language. At the same time, the state language will become the main working language of the public service.

The text states that this concept aims to create the priority and prestige of the Kazakh language in all areas of society.

According to the document, the proportion of the country’s population speaking the Kazakh language is expected to reach 84% by 2029. The concept states that this rate will be 81% in 2023.

He also points out that today “public relations in Kazakhstan are conducted primarily in Russian.”
